Welcome to the Maplight plugin program. This snippet covers the Tintshed tile-rendering cache layer, which your plugins interact with through the `CacheScope` API. Tiles are keyed by zoom, layer hash, and style version; never construct keys manually, as eviction depends on the canonical format. Writes are asynchronous, so always check the commit callback before assuming persistence. During sandbox enrollment, the recovery vault must be initialized with the passphrase shown below this paragraph.

unlock words, fafop-hawep: briwyn-oliix-sorox

Welcome to the Ledgerpine on-call rotation. The tax-rate lookup cache (service: ratevault) refreshes nightly at 02:00. If rates look stale, check the refresh job first, then invalidate by jurisdiction, never globally. Global flushes hammer the upstream registry and page everyone. Escalate only if the refresh fails twice. Runbook, dashboards, and invalidation commands are all on the page below.

operations page: https://jira.qorvelsys.internal/browse/pages/browse/pages

Subject: Partner SFTP drop — new owner

Hi,

As you review the pending changes to the Harborline ingest scripts, note that ownership of the partner SFTP drop is changing at the end of the month. This includes key rotation, the nightly pull job, and the quarantine folder for malformed files. Review comments on the retry logic should still go through the normal PR flow, but questions about drop-folder conventions or partner onboarding now go to the new owner. The incoming owner is listed below.

signatory, tagaf-bahaf: Praael Fenmir Rusok